Johann Ludwig Tieck (; German: [tiːk]; 31 May 1773 – 28 April 1853) was a German poet, fiction writer, translator, and critic. He was one of the founding fathers of the Romantic movement in the late 18th and early 19th centuries. Read more on Wikipedia
His biography is available in different languages on Wikipedia. Ludwig Tieck is the 611th most popular writer (up from 628th in 2019), the 601st most popular biography from Germany (down from 592nd in 2019) and the 35th most popular German Writer.
Ludwig Tieck is most famous for his fairy tales and his work as a literary critic.
